PS - Some build info......
The rear hinge pivot is 5/16" or 8mm Tassie Oak dowel...
The tail gate hinge pivot is 1/4" or 6.5mm Tassie Oak dowel with a 1/8" lock dowel...
The headlights & taillights are furniture plugs....
The wheel are 2" or 50mm shop bought American Oak wheels...
